A charity supporting individuals with disabilities is looking for a Support and Development Worker in the United Kingdom. This role involves delivering high-quality services to individuals with spina bifida and/or hydrocephalus and their families, promoting independence and well-being.

You will represent the charity at clinics and provide crucial support and information to members across various regions.

Ideal candidates have relevant experience and excellent communication skills. The position allows working from home with occasional travel, offering a competitive salary and generous holidays.

How to prepare for a job interview at SHINE Charity

✨Know Your Stuff

Make sure you understand the charity's mission and the specific needs of individuals with spina bifida and hydrocephalus. Research their services and think about how your experience aligns with their goals. This will show your genuine interest and commitment to the role.

✨Showcase Your Communication Skills

As a Community Support & Development Worker, communication is key. Prepare examples of how you've effectively communicated with clients or team members in the past. Be ready to demonstrate your ability to listen actively and provide clear information, as this will be crucial in supporting individuals and their families.

✨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ations related to the role. Think about scenarios where you had to promote independence or well-being for someone in need. Practising your responses can help you articulate your thought process and problem-solving skills during the interview.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, have a few questions ready to ask the interviewer. This could be about the charity's future projects or how they measure success in their support services. Asking insightful questions shows your enthusiasm for the role and helps you determine if it's the right fit for you.
